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.
These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.
Domestic Students
- Completed Diploma of Counselling or equivalent qualifications OR
- Evidence of relevant skills, knowledge and employment experience OR
- Hold an undergraduate degree or higher qualification in Counselling, Psychology, Social Work, Social Science or equivalent.
